The Jacksonville Jaguars denied an ESPN report that coach Doug Marrone would be fired after Sunday’s game. ESPN, citing a source, reported earlier Saturday that the team had informed Marrone that the home game against the Indianapolis Colts would be his last. “Reports that Doug Marrone will be dismissed after Sunday’s game are 100 percent incorrect,” read a statement from Jim Woodcock, a spokesman for owner Shad Khan. Prior to joining Bradley’s staff in Jacksonville in 2015, Marrone was 15-17 as the head coach of the Buffalo Bills from 2013-14. Marrone played parts of two seasons in the NFL as an offensive lineman with the Miami Dolphins (1987) and New Orleans Saints (1989).
